ABSTRACT


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) is a high-quality bus-based transportation that offers comfort, safety, punctuality, good infrastructure, and a scheduled system. Factors that cause traffic accidents include human error, mechanical failure, road conditions and situations, and weather factors. According to the Ministry of Transportation of the Republic of Indonesia, human factors dominate the causes of traffic accidents, where driver fatigue is the leading cause of accidents. This study aims to determine the description of work fatigue among bus rapid transit drivers at Trans Metro Dewata Bali in 2023. This research is quantitative descriptive research with a cross-sectional study approach. The research location is in the Trans Metro Dewata Bali Bus Corridor.The minimum sample size is 78 samples obtained by non-probability sampling technique with a consecutive sampling approach. Data was collected by in-person interviews using respondent's questionnaire and the KAUPK2 questionnaire to measure work fatigue. Data analysis used univariate analysis and cross-tabulation analysis. The results showed that most of the rapid transit bus drivers on the Trans Metro Dewata Bali in 2023 had a level of work fatigue in the tired category of 39 people (48.8%). Companies are expected to provide information related to occupational health and safety, especially work fatigue.


Keywords: Bus Rapid Transit, Driver, Work Fatigue
